Aug 16, 2023 · Press the ˊ Settings ˋ icon. Tap “ General management ”. Tap “ Reset ”. Touch ˊ Factory data reset ˋ. Press ˊ RESET ˋ. Press “ DELETE ALL ”. Wait a moment while the factory default settings are restored. Follow the instructions on the screen to set up your Samsung Galaxy S8 and prepare it for use. Removes all data including photos, videos, contacts, apps, etc. Reset disabled Galaxy..., To back up data before factory resetting Samsung: Go to "Settings" > "Accounts and backup". Tap "Samsung Cloud". Scroll down to tap "Back up data". Confirm the selected files, tap "Back up" on the bottom of the page. When the process is finished, tap "Done".
